Private jet empty legs
Paris → Nice
Paris to Nice is France's highest-frequency internal private aviation corridor — 1h 20min light-jet hop from Le Bourget (LFPB, Europe's premier business aviation airport) to Nice Côte d'Azur (LFMN). Weekday morning outbound + evening return dominates business flow; weekend leisure surge May through October during Riviera season. Charter pricing €5,500-10,000 light jet; empty legs €3,500-6,500. Cannes Film Festival (May) + Monaco Grand Prix (late May) + Cannes Yachting Festival (September) generate concentrated event-driven demand + subsequent empty leg supply.

Why this route has empty legs
Weekday business traffic asymmetry + weekend leisure surge creates strong empty leg supply on both weekly patterns. Consistent flow year-round; particularly strong May-October Riviera season.
Seasonality
Peak: May-October (Riviera season). Extreme peak: Cannes Film Festival (mid-May), Monaco GP (late May), Cannes Yachting Festival (Sep). Weekly business flow: strong Mon-Thu year-round.

Frequently asked questions
Le Bourget vs CDG for Paris origin?+
Le Bourget (LFPB) is Europe's premier business aviation airport — 10 min north of Paris, dedicated FBOs (Advanced Air, Jet Aviation, Signature, Dassault Falcon Service). Every European business flyer defaults to LFPB. Charles de Gaulle (LFPG) private terminal exists but has slot restrictions + commercial mixing.
Nice (LFMN) vs Cannes-Mandelieu (LFMD)?+
LFMN is the main airport — full FBO, 6 min from Nice + 25 min to Monaco. LFMD (Cannes-Mandelieu) is smaller — 15 min to Cannes centre, preferred for Cannes-specific arrivals (film festival). LFMD runway 5,200 ft handles most business jets.
Onward from Nice — Monaco, Cannes, St Tropez?+
Monaco: 25 min drive from LFMN. Cannes: 30 min drive from LFMN, 15 min from LFMD. St Tropez: 90 min drive from either, or helicopter transfer (Heli Air Monaco + Monacair operate) — 20 min, €800-1,200 per seat.
Empty leg supply patterns Paris-Nice?+
Two overlapping patterns: (1) Business — Mon-Thu Paris → Nice + evening return; (2) Leisure — Fri-Sat outbound + Sun-Mon return. Combined: this corridor has among the most predictable European empty leg supply of any major domestic route.
